Abstract:
A structure and a method for assembling a heat exchanger combined with tubes of a plurality of rows are provided to improve the assembling efficiency and the productivity by inserting integrated caps into both ends of header pipes after assembling tubes with the header pipes. A plurality of tubes(22,24) are combined with header pipes(12,14) while forming a plurality of rows in a width direction of the header pipes to form refrigerant moving paths in a plurality of rows. The header pipes are formed of a plurality of independent pipes combined with the tubes of each row. Sides of the pipes are closely adhered to each other so that both ends of the pipes of a length direction are fixed by integrated caps(16,18). Refrigerant communication holes(12b) are formed at the sides to convert a moving direction of the refrigerant. Fixing members are inserted into both ends of the sides of the pipes to assist fixing of the integrated caps.
Abstract:
A water refrigerant type heat exchanger is provided to increase heat exchange efficiency by making cooling water of a low temperature and gas refrigerant of a high temperature flow in the opposite directions, and simplify installation of the heat exchanger in a small space. A water refrigerant type heat exchanger includes a tube element(110) formed of a plurality of tubes. The tube element has a first flat tube(112) for passing cooling water of low temperature and having both horizontal ends, and two second tubes(114) for passing gas refrigerant of high temperature and having both ends(114a,114b) apart from each other in the opposite direction from the first tubes. The second tubes are stacked at both sides of the first tube, so that middles parts of the both ends of the second tube are in close contact with top and bottom surfaces of the first tube. A plurality of headers are first and second cooling water headers(122,124) and U-shaped third and fourth refrigerant headers(126,128). The first and second cooling water headers are connected to both ends of the first tube in the vertical direction, wherein one end of each of the headers is blocked by a cap(126a) and the other end is connected to a pipe for a cooling water circuit. The third and fourth refrigerant headers connected to the both ends of the second tubes in the vertical direction, wherein one end of each of the headers is blocked by a cap(128a) and the other end is connected to a pipe of a refrigerant circuit.
Abstract:
PURPOSE: A method of pre-assembling a baffle of a heat exchanger is provided to simplifying a process a baffle and a header pipe and to reduce manufacturing costs by simplifying a pre-assembling process. CONSTITUTION: A method of pre-assembling a baffle of a heat exchanger comprises the following steps. A baffle(110) which is arranged in the inside of a header pipe(120) in order to divide a flow passage of refrigerant is pre-assembled before brazing. A recess(126) is formed on the inside wall of the part in which a baffle hole(122) which the baffle is inserted is formed in the header pipe. The baffle is temporary assembled to the header pipe while forming a protruded part(112) which is obstinately inserted in the recess in both sides of the baffle. A sloped face is formed on the both sides of the protruded part and the recess. An assembling check face is formed on both sides of the baffle. The assembling check face corresponds with the both edge shape of the baffle hole of the header pipe.

Abstract:
A header for a high pressure heat exchanger is provided to improve the machining property of a thick header by pressing, cutting or in combination thereof, simplify the structure of the header, and increasing pressure-resistance thereof. A header for a high pressure heat exchanger includes a first header pipe(42) formed with a refrigerant flowing space(S1) inside and a first plane joining surface(42a) at a side, and a second header pipe(44) formed with a refrigerant channel(S2) inside and a second plane joining surface(44a) at a side to be brazed with the first plane joining surface in close contact. A tube insertion hole(42b,44b) is formed at a corner of each of the first and second header pipes so that tubes are inserted thereinto. The tube fitting holes are connected to each other by the brazing between the first and second header pipes.

Abstract:
P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a waste heat management system and management method for an electric vehicle improving the fuel economy of the electric vehicle by utilizing waste heat from an OBC (onboard charger) and a motor for indoor heating and preheating of the motor.SOLUTION: The waste heat management system for the electric vehicle includes a water pump for controlling the flow of cooling water; an OBC cooling water line and a motor cooling water line branched in parallel on the outlet side of a cooling water line of the water pump; and a heater core cooling water line and a radiator cooling water line connected in parallel to the inlet side of the water pump cooling water line and to an outlet side confluence point of the OBC cooling water line and motor cooling water line respectively. The outlet side of the water pump cooling water line and the branched inlet side of the OBC cooling water line and motor cooling water line are connected by a first valve, and the outlet side confluence point of the OBC cooling water line and motor cooling water line, the heater core cooling water line, and the radiator cooling water line are connected by a second valve.
Abstract:
PURPOSE: A heating device for a vehicle and method using a PTC heater is provided to reduce the maximum current used in a positive temperature co-efficient heater by minimizing an inrush current. CONSTITUTION: A heating device for a vehicle using a PTC heater comprises an input unit(110), a controller(100), a power supply unit(120), and a temperature sensing unit. A preset temperature is inputted in the input unit by a user. The controller outputs a PWM(Pulse Width Modulation) control signal. According to the PWM control signal from the controller, the power supply unit turns the power on or off. The temperature sensing unit measures the temperature of the air discharged from the positive temperature co-efficient heater. The controller outputs the PWM control signal for controlling the output of the positive temperature co-efficient heater.
Abstract:
An oil cooler is provided to reduce the number of manufacturing processes and the manufacturing cost without employing an additional heat transfer fin in the oil cooler. An oil cooler includes a body(50), an oil intake pipe, and an oil discharge pipe. The body includes an inner pipe(52) and an outer pipe(54). An oil flows between the inner pipe and the outer pipe. The oil introduction pipe and the oil discharge pipe are joined with both sides of the body to introduce and discharge the oil between the inner pipe and the outer pipe. The inner pipe is a flat pipe. The outer pipe is a bellows pipe. The outer pipe makes contact with the inner pipe, and the bellow pipe is formed between the inner and outer pipes.
